Запитання з тегом «ios»

iOS - це мобільна операційна система, що працює на Apple iPhone, iPod touch та iPad Apple. Використовуйте цей тег [ios] для питань, пов’язаних із програмуванням на платформі iOS. Використовуйте відповідні теги [aim-c] та [swift] для питань, характерних для цих мов програмування.

21
Як змінити розмір зображення в Swift?
Я роблю додаток для iOS, використовуючи Swift та Parse.com Я намагаюся дозволити користувачеві вибрати зображення із засобу вибору зображень, а потім змінити розмір вибраного зображення до 200x200 пікселів перед завантаженням у мій сервер. Parse.com має підручник для програми для копіювання в Instagram під назвою "AnyPic", який дає цей код для …
93 ios  swift  uiimage 


1
Як я можу визначити, чи мій додаток React Native є налагодженням або випуском збірки з коду JavaScript?
Я хотів би додати трохи інтерфейсу лише для налагодження до мого додатку React Native, але я не можу знайти жодного еквівалента RCT_DEBUGабо RCT_DEVпрапорців часу компіляції в середовищі JavaScript. Є такий? Приклад використання: Я хочу додати рядок стану, який відображає кількість запитів HTTP, ініційованих моїм додатком. Очевидно, що це не є …

2
Авторозкладка ігнорується у користувацькому UITableViewCell
Незважаючи на те, що встановили обмеження для всіх елементів, включаючи вертикальні, необхідні для того, щоб комірка обчислила свою висоту, авторозкладка, схоже, ігнорується: усі комірки стискаються. Ось знімок екрана результату та обмежень у розкадруванні. У VC, який містить tableView, ось код у viewDidLoad: tableView.estimatedRowHeight = 120.0 tableView.rowHeight = UITableViewAutomaticDimension Коментування другого …
93 ios  swift  uitableview 

12
Що таке розмір знімка екрана App Store для 6,5-дюймового дисплея?
Мабуть, документація Apple не може встигати за змінами в App Store. До сьогодні найбільшим (додатковим) розміром дисплея був 5,8-дюймовий Super Retina Display з роздільною здатністю 1125 x 2436 пікселів. На даний момент це 6,5-дюймовий дисплей, але роздільної здатності ніде не знайти (документи на https://help.apple.com/app-store-connect/#/devd274dd925 згадують лише 5,8-дюймовий дисплей). App store …

4
Як створити анімацію відмов UIView?
У мене є така CATransition для UIView під назвою finalScoreView, завдяки чому він виходить на екран зверху: CATransition *animation = [CATransition animation]; animation.duration = 0.2; animation.type = kCATransitionPush; animation.subtype = kCATransitionFromBottom; animation.timingFunction = [CAMediaTimingFunction functionWithName:kCAMediaTimingFunctionEaseIn]; [gameOver.layer addAnimation:animation forKey:@"changeTextTransition"]; [finalScoreView.layer addAnimation:animation forKey:@"changeTextTransition"]; Як зробити так, щоб він відскакував один раз після …

23
Позиціонування MKMapView для відображення кількох анотацій одночасно
У мене є кілька приміток, які я хочу додати до свого MKMapView (це може 0-n елементів, де n, як правило, близько 5). Я можу додати примітки до штрафу, але хочу змінити розмір карти, щоб одразу помістити всі анотації на екрані, і я не знаю, як це зробити. Я дивився, -regionThatFits:але …

5
Авторозкладка iOS: дві кнопки однакової ширини, поруч
Зараз у мене виникають труднощі з AutoLayout. Я використовую конструктор інтерфейсів і намагаюся розташувати дві кнопки однакової ширини поруч, як показано на наступному зображенні. З наступного зображення попереднього перегляду мій titleImage був належним чином обмежений і відображається правильно, однак кнопки ні. Я експериментував, вирівнявши кнопку 1 з переднім краєм titleImage, …
92 ios  iphone  xcode  autolayout 


7
Як отримати текст у CATextLayer, щоб було зрозуміло
Я зробив a CALayerз доданим, CATextLayerі текст виходить розмитим. У документах вони говорять про "згладжування субпікселів", але це не означає для мене багато. Хто-небудь має фрагмент коду, який робить а CATextLayerз трохи чіткого тексту? Ось текст з документації Apple: Примітка: CATextLayer вимикає згладжування субпікселів під час відтворення тексту. Текст можна …

4
presentViewController: збій на iOS <6 (AutoLayout)
Я отримую дивний збій. Збій відбувається, коли я натискаю кнопку, яка переходить до певного ViewController. Рядок, на якому він виходить з ладу: DestinationInformationViewController *info = [[DestinationInformationViewController alloc] init]; [info setModalTransitionStyle: UIModalTransitionStyleCrossDissolve]; [self presentViewController:info animated:YES completion: nil]; // CRASHES HERE [info release]; Трасування збоїв: *** Terminating app due to uncaught exception …


15
Коли використовувати UICollectionView замість UITableView?
Я виявив, що UICollectionViewце схоже на оновлену версію, UITableViewпредставлену в iOS6, але коли я повинен вибрати UICollectionViewзамість цього UITableView? Є додатки UITableView, які все ще використовують , якщо UICollectionViewхтось UITableViewможе зробити, чому люди все ще користуються UITableView? Чи є різниця щодо продуктивності? Дякую!

6
Що робить перевага Xcode 4.2 “Підтримка бездротових з’єднаних пристроїв”?
У Xcode 4.2 на вкладці «Загальне» є нова настройка, яка називається «Відкриття пристрою iOS» із встановленим прапорцем «Підтримка бездротових підключених пристроїв». Що робить цей варіант? Після перевірки, як ми можемо використовувати цю нову можливість?

4
“Фатальна помилка: масив неможливо зв’язати з Objective-C” - Чому ти взагалі намагаєшся, Свіфте?
Я оголосив протокол Swift: protocol Option { var name: String { get } } Я заявляю про декілька реалізацій цього протоколу - деякі класи, деякі перелічення. У мене є контролер перегляду з властивістю, оголошеною так: var options: [Option] = [] Коли я намагаюся встановити для цього властивості масив об'єктів, що …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.